A structured lifestyle program produced a small additional cognitive gain over active self-guided support
In a two-year randomized trial of 2,111 adults aged 60–79 at elevated risk of cognitive decline, both interventions addressed physical activity, cognitive activity, healthy diet, social engagement, and cardiovascular health monitoring. Global cognition improved in both groups, with the more structured and intensive program improving by 0.029 standard deviations per year more than the lower-intensity self-guided program.
Research basis
Single-blind, multicenter randomized clinical trial. Adults aged 60–79 who were sedentary, had suboptimal diets, and met additional dementia-risk criteria.
What it supports
Modifiable lifestyle drivers can influence measured cognition in the studied older, at-risk population.
Boundary
The trial involved older adults selected for elevated cognitive-decline risk. It did not study executives, workplace outcomes, healthy midlife populations, or integrated Biological Capacity. The functional and long-term clinical importance of the small difference remains uncertain.
